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
124 94 819441818 46 38713039389
033402119 0485073014
033402119 0485073014
6278 09281 0109560820
All about undefined
Interested in learning more?
033402119 0485073014
6278 09281 0109560820
See more
8493707306 5029
678625 808117 012118903 012484397
See more
03045 1039 7475872
069866 6401 5507 00911749729
See more